    Description

    The USRP-2940 USRP Software-Defined Radio Device is a cutting-edge product manufactured by National Instruments. This device is recognized by its part numbers 783146-01 and 783923-01, marking its significance in the USRP series. It’s designed to be highly compatible with programming environments, specifically with NI-USRP instrument driver and LabVIEW, making it a versatile choice for engineers and developers.

    Ensuring broad accessibility, the device is compatible with the Windows operating system. Its connectivity is enhanced through MXIe and Ethernet bus interfaces, allowing for seamless integration into existing setups. The architecture of the device is based on RIO, ensuring robust performance and reliability.

    With 2 Input Channels and 2 Output Channels, the USRP-2940 provides ample capability for various radio frequency applications. It supports a transmitting gain step of 1.0 dB and a receiving gain step of 0.5 dB, offering precise control over signal strength. At its core, the device is powered by the Kintex-7 410T FPGA, known for its high-performance processing capabilities.

    The RF frequency range of this device spans from 50 MHz to 2.2 GHz, covering a wide spectrum for numerous applications. It is especially suited for advanced radio communication and signal processing tasks, including MIMO, LTE Relaying, Heterogeneous Networks Synchronization, RF Sampling, Antenna Beamforming, Direction Finding, and Cognitive Radio.     Specification Details
    Product Name USRP-2940 USRP Software-Defined Radio Device
    Manufacturer National Instruments
    Part Numbers 783146-01, 783923-01
    Series USRP
    Programming Compatibility NI-USRP instrument driver, LabVIEW
    Operating System Compatibility Windows
    Bus Interface MXIe, Ethernet
    Channels 2 Input Channels, 2 Output Channels
    Architecture RIO
    Transmitting Gain Step 1.0 dB
    Receiving Gain Step 0.5 dB
    FPGA Kintex-7 410T
    RF Frequency Range 50 MHz to 2.2 GHz
    Applications MIMO, LTE Relaying, Heterogeneous Networks Synchronization, RF Sampling, Antenna Beamforming, Direction Finding, Cognitive Radio
